Get A QuoteHowever they arrived, the M’Goun Valley – or the Vallée des Roses, as it’s known in Morocco – has become famous for its flowers. Every year during the main growing season between April andmid-May, the valley produces between 3000 and 4000 tonnes of wild roses.

Get A QuoteMar 21, 2013· At the small town of El KelaaM'Gouna(also referred to as theValley of Roses) in the South of Morocco, a 140km East of Ouarzazate, in the heart of DadesValleyone can see the manual harvest of Damasrosesand theRoseFestival in May each year. There is a thriving local industry distillingrosewater, introduced by the French in the 1930's and cosmetic products such as soaps, gels, creams ...
